What Key Features Should You Look for in an Inexpensive Convection Toaster Oven?
When searching for the best inexpensive convection toaster oven, consider the following key features:
- Convection Technology: Ensure the toaster oven has a convection fan that circulates hot air for even cooking. This feature not only improves cooking efficiency but also helps achieve a crispy texture on foods like pizza and roasted vegetables.
- Size and Capacity: Look for a model that fits your kitchen space and meets your cooking needs. A good size will accommodate standard baking trays and allow you to prepare meals for individuals or small families comfortably.
- Temperature Range: A wide temperature range allows for versatile cooking options. Aim for a toaster oven that can reach at least 450°F, enabling you to bake, broil, toast, and reheat various dishes effectively.
- Ease of Use: Check for user-friendly controls, such as intuitive knobs or digital displays. Features like preset cooking functions and easy-to-read indicators can significantly enhance your cooking experience.
- Cleaning and Maintenance: Removable crumb trays and non-stick interiors simplify cleaning. Look for models with easy-to-wipe surfaces that prevent food build-up and make maintenance hassle-free.
- Power and Performance: A higher wattage typically indicates better performance and faster cooking times. Toaster ovens with around 1500 watts are generally efficient and can handle various cooking tasks quickly.
- Safety Features: Ensure the toaster oven has safety features like auto shut-off and cool-touch exteriors. These features help prevent accidents and ensure safe operation, especially in households with children.
- Warranty and Customer Support: A good warranty period reflects the manufacturer’s confidence in their product. Look for brands that offer reliable customer support to assist with any issues or questions after purchase.

How Should You Maintain Your Inexpensive Convection Toaster Oven for Optimal Performance?
To maintain your inexpensive convection toaster oven for optimal performance, consider these essential practices:
- Regular Cleaning: Keeping your toaster oven clean is crucial for maintaining its efficiency and longevity. Wipe down the interior and exterior surfaces with a damp cloth after each use, and remove any food particles or spills that may have accumulated.
- Check and Replace the Heating Elements: Over time, the heating elements may wear out or become damaged. Regularly inspect them for any signs of wear, and replace them if necessary to ensure even cooking and baking.
- Avoid Overloading: To achieve the best results, avoid overloading your toaster oven with food. This can restrict airflow, leading to uneven cooking and may put extra strain on the appliance, potentially shortening its lifespan.
- Use the Right Cookware: Using appropriate cookware is essential for optimal performance. Make sure to use oven-safe dishes that fit well within the toaster oven, as improper sizing can lead to inefficient cooking and possible damage to the appliance.
- Calibrate the Temperature: If you notice inconsistencies in cooking times or temperatures, consider calibrating your toaster oven. Use an oven thermometer to check the accuracy of the temperature settings and make adjustments as needed for best results.
- Ventilation Maintenance: Ensure that the ventilation areas of the toaster oven are not blocked. Proper airflow is essential for efficient operation and prevents overheating, which can damage the appliance.
- Periodic Deep Cleaning: Beyond regular cleaning, perform a deep clean periodically to remove grease buildup and prevent odors. This includes removing and washing the crumb tray, racks, and any removable parts according to the manufacturer’s instructions.
What Common Issues Should You Expect with Inexpensive Convection Toaster Ovens?
When considering the best inexpensive convection toaster ovens, there are several common issues to be aware of:
- Uneven Cooking: Inexpensive models may not have the most efficient fan systems, leading to hotspots and uneven cooking results.
- Limited Temperature Control: Many budget convection toaster ovens lack precise temperature settings, which can make it difficult to achieve optimal cooking results.
- Smaller Capacity: The size of inexpensive convection toaster ovens often restricts the amount of food you can cook at one time, limiting their usefulness for larger meals.
- Shorter Lifespan: Cheaper materials and construction can lead to a shorter lifespan, with components failing more quickly than their higher-priced counterparts.
- Inconsistent Timer Function: Budget models may have unreliable timers that can lead to undercooked or overcooked food.
- Noise Levels: The fans in inexpensive units can often be louder than expected, which can be distracting during cooking.
- Lack of Additional Features: Many lower-cost ovens miss out on advanced features like multiple rack positions, broil settings, or digital displays that can enhance cooking versatility.
Uneven cooking can become a significant issue when using inexpensive convection toaster ovens, as the fans may not distribute heat effectively throughout the cooking chamber. This can result in certain areas of food being overcooked while others remain undercooked, requiring more attention and rotation during the cooking process.
Limited temperature control is another common problem, as many budget options feature fewer temperature settings or less accurate thermostats. This can make it challenging to achieve specific cooking temperatures consistently, impacting the quality of baked goods and roasted items.
The smaller capacity of inexpensive models often means they can only accommodate limited food quantities, making them less suitable for families or those who enjoy hosting gatherings. Users may find themselves needing to cook in multiple batches, which can be time-consuming.
Shorter lifespans are typical with budget toaster ovens, as they are often constructed with lower-quality materials that may wear out more quickly. Users might notice that heating elements or other components fail after a relatively short period, leading to additional expenses for replacements.
An inconsistent timer function can also pose challenges, as it may lead to improperly cooked meals. Users can experience frustrations when relying on inaccurate timers, resulting in food that is either undercooked or burnt due to unexpected shutdowns.
Noise levels can be an unexpected downside with inexpensive convection toaster ovens, as the fans intended to circulate heat can produce more noise than higher-end models. This can detract from the cooking experience, especially in smaller kitchens or open living spaces.
Lastly, the lack of additional features in budget models can limit the versatility of the toaster oven. Without options like multiple rack positions or broil settings, users may find themselves constrained in how they can prepare different types of meals, making these models less adaptable to diverse cooking needs.
